Latest Patents
Among Killop's latest inventions are pivotal advancements in power transmission members. His patents detail a spline rolling method and apparatus that features a pair of racks designed to create splines. These splines have ends that oppose each other, maintained in a precisely spaced relationship at an annular groove. This design is crucial for the secure positioning of snap rings or other fasteners, which assists in axially locating the power transmission member during operation.
